Zach Jooste
Zach Jooste

Bredasdorp, Western Cape, South Africa

581

SportyHQ Rating

69%

Rating Confidence

14

Matches YTD

237

Matches All Time

Zach's Rankings
More about Zach
Please sign in
Zach's fans

Darren Philipps

Cape Town, Western Cape, South Africa
Affiliated Governing Bodies
Affiliated Clubs
Tournament History

0 people have viewed your profile in the past 30 days.

Please sign in